Fertility indicators in 2009

  • Value: 1.5 children per woman
  • Change vs 2008: +0.02 children per woman (+1.35 %)
  • Position in history: below the 65-year average (average — 1.6811 children per woman)
  • Series maximum — 2.66 children per woman in 1964 (45 years ago)
  • Series minimum — 1.29 children per woman in 2024
  • Value date: 1 January 2009
  • Source: Eurostat
